U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) officers made a seizure on Sunday, June 12 at the Los Indios International Bridge after officers discovered marijuana inside a vehicle.

CBP officers came into contact with a 24-year-old man driving a gray 1996 Hyundai Accent at the Los Indios International Bridge. The man was identified as a United States citizen who resides in Los Indios.

According to a CBP press release, after being referred for further inspection, CBP officers discovered a large package hidden inside the trunk of the Hyundai. The package allegedly contained 41.98 kilograms, (92.6 pounds) of marijuana, an estimated street value of approximately $92,600.

The Los Indios man was turned over to U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ement-Homeland Security Investigations (ICE-HSI) special agents for further investigation.

“Our CBP officers’ work on the frontline was instrumental to the detection of this load of marijuana and the arrest of this alleged smuggler,” said Michael Freeman, Port Director of Brownsville. “I congratulate our officers for an outstanding job with this seizure and for their continued efforts in keeping drugs out of our country.”
